Skip to content
View yahiaetman's full-sized avatar

Block or report yahiaetman

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Maximum 250 characters. Please don't include any personal information such as legal names or email addresses. Mark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se

Starred repositories

64 stars written in C
Clear filter

A simple and easy-to-use library to enjoy videogames programming

C 29,776 2,812 Updated Dec 19, 2025

High performance UI layout library in C.

C 16,168 625 Updated Dec 5, 2025

mimalloc is a compact general purpose allocator with excellent performance.

C 12,287 1,034 Updated Dec 10, 2025

Extremely fast non-cryptographic hash algorithm

C 10,630 873 Updated Dec 17, 2025

Box2D is a 2D physics engine for games

C 9,386 1,710 Updated Dec 15, 2025

The “Quite OK Image Format” for fast, lossless image compression

C 7,367 360 Updated Nov 13, 2025

A native, user-mode, multi-process, graphical debugger.

C 6,371 271 Updated Dec 20, 2025

Collection of cross-platform one-file C/C++ libraries with no dependencies, primarily used for games

C 4,881 294 Updated Sep 2, 2025

Gravity Programming Language

C 4,449 236 Updated Apr 14, 2025

Jsmn is a world fastest JSON parser/tokenizer. This is the official repo replacing the old one at Bitbucket

C 4,012 806 Updated Jun 9, 2024

Single C file, Realtime CPU/GPU Profiler with Remote Web Viewer

C 3,272 281 Updated Aug 28, 2024

Easy to integrate Vulkan memory allocation library

C 3,132 412 Updated Nov 30, 2025

Implementations of SIMD instruction sets for systems which don't natively support them.

C 2,885 292 Updated Dec 18, 2025

A fast and lightweight 2D game physics library.

C 2,353 359 Updated Apr 15, 2025

Single-file public domain libraries for C/C++

C 2,132 143 Updated Sep 6, 2025

Umka: a statically typed embeddable scripting language

C 1,901 76 Updated Dec 10, 2025

Meta loader for Vulkan API

C 1,677 143 Updated Dec 19, 2025

ORX: Portable Game Engine

C 1,653 112 Updated Dec 15, 2025

Ultra-portable, high performance, open source multimedia framework.

C 1,591 168 Updated Oct 8, 2025

A cross platform lightweight single-header simple-to-use window abstraction library for creating graphical programs or libraries.

C 1,566 64 Updated Dec 20, 2025

Two-Level Segregated Fit memory allocator implementation.

C 1,454 219 Updated Nov 6, 2021

A simple math library for games and computer graphics. Compatible with both C and C++. Public domain and easy to modify.

C 1,454 102 Updated Feb 24, 2025

A game engine made as part of the Kohi Game Engine series on YouTube (and Twitch!), where we make a game engine from the ground up using C and Vulkan.

C 1,347 99 Updated Dec 18, 2025

Single source file FBX loader

C 1,202 78 Updated Dec 8, 2025

MiniFB is a small cross platform library to create a frame buffer that you can draw pixels in

C 1,150 89 Updated Nov 16, 2025

A framework for rapid prototyping and development of real-time rendering techniques.

C 1,029 79 Updated Dec 19, 2025

Hash map implementation in C.

C 981 134 Updated Aug 19, 2025

single-file C libraries from Philip Allan Rideout

C 941 71 Updated Sep 27, 2025

A virtual machine for Haxe

C 851 181 Updated Dec 20, 2025

High-performance, real-time optimized, and statically typed embedded language implemented in C.

C 816 21 Updated Dec 18, 2025
Next